#pray4boshThe Heat (calf) have "serious concerns" about Chris Bosh's health, according to Barry Jackson of the Miami Herald.
The report adds Bosh's agent said it's "too soon to report" if he has another blood clot. Bosh did not play in the All-Star Game due to strained calf and he has returned to Miami for more tests. The good news is that Bosh's health concerns are not life-threatening, according to the report. Hopefully we get good news on Tuesday.
Source: Miami Herald Feb 15 - 11:21 PM
